3. 30 Wears

This app encourages you to wear every piece of clothing you own at least 30 times in order to avoid impulse purchases. Simply by uploading selfies of your already owned items of clothing, you can keep track of what you’re wearing day-to-day.

5. Sojo

The new Deliveroo-style app for clothing alterations and repairs. Need a dress altered or repaired? Simply specify a pickup location, and someone will arrive to collect your items and deliver them to your local seamstress, and then once finished, they will deliver them back to you.

9. AWorld

This app encourages you to make small sustainable steps in your everyday life and track the overall impact you have. For example, it allows you to log when you have taken a shorter shower, used a reusable bag at the supermarket, or turned off the light when leaving a room.

11. Ecosia

The search engine that plants trees! Your searches plant trees in some of the harshest places on Earth. These trees will benefit people, the environment, and local economies. It works just like any other internet browser, but every 45 searches, it is estimated that you will plant one tree, allowing you to browse the internet for hours, guilt-free!

12. Olio

With Olio, you can help reduce food and waste in your area. Simply snap a photo of your unwanted item(s), set a pickup location, and anyone in your local area will be notified. From our experience, it’s quick and easy, and is a great way to get rid of stuff you no longer use/need.
